How Much Hawaii?

My son has just graduated from college and before he settles down to a "real" job he intends to go to Hawaii and work on an organic farm. He will be flying from Seattle to Honolulu sometime between Feb. and March. He wants to purchase tickets now. Best fares on Expedia and Orbitz are with Northwest at around $475 RT. They quickly go up to $600-$700 dollars on other carriers He thinks that they will keep going up. I told him that there are usually fare sales right after New Years. Is $475 a good fare? Any thoughts on fare sales after New Years?

Sometime between February and March are peak travel season for Hawaii. $475 is a reasonable deal. The longer you wait, the more tickets are sold, the higher the price.

it is supply and demand- in the summer you can get fares for $250-$350 r/t but in the winter prices climb.
i would suggest he go to a council travel type agent normally associated with youth fares and other deals.
when i was his age i saved a lot of $$ on my flights with them.
